Dol Turf is a recognized leader in the sports turf industry as a full-service provider specializing in turf services, bespoke construction, restoration and management of sports fields, and golf courses.

We are currently looking for a full-time permanent Site Supervisor to join our growing team. Reporting to the General Manager, the Site Supervisor is responsible for overseeing day-to-day operations on commercial and municipal landscape projects. This role ensures projects are completed safely, on time, within budget, and to high-quality standards. The Supervisor leads and motivates site crews, coordinates materials and equipment, and serves as the primary on-site contact for clients, subcontractors, and management. The incumbent must be able to successfully blend management, technical knowledge and strong communication skills.

Key Duties and Responsibilities:

Project Supervision & Execution

  • Oversee all on-site activities including grading, hardscaping, planting, irrigation, and related work.
  • Interpret landscape and construction drawings, specifications, and work orders to ensure compliance with project plans.
  • Collaborates with Scheduler to coordinate crew assignments, subcontractors, materials, and equipment needs.
  • Monitor project progress, resolve on-site issues, and report updates to management.
  • Ensure adherence to design, quality, and workmanship standards.
  • Serve as the on-site point of contact for clients, inspectors, and project managers.
  • Communicate site progress, delays, or changes clearly and promptly to client and internal management team in a professional manner
  • Manage the project budget by monitoring material and labor costs.

Leadership & Staff Management

  • Supervise and mentor crew members, promoting teamwork, efficiency, and professionalism.
  • Train new staff in proper work techniques, tool and machine use, and safety practices.
  • Conduct daily site briefings and ensure all workers understand their tasks and responsibilities.
  • Track employee hours, performance, and attendance on site.

Health, Safety & Compliance

  • Enforce compliance with Ontario Occupational Health and Safety Act (OHSA) and company safety policies.
  • Conduct daily safety inspections and hazard assessments and maintain a clean, organized, and safe job site.

Administration & Reporting

  • Maintain daily job logs, material usage records, and equipment maintenance reports.
  • Assist with project cost tracking, time sheets, and change orders.
  • Support management in estimating, scheduling, and project closeout tasks.

Qualifications:

Education & Experience

  • Minimum 3–5 years of experience in landscape or construction site supervision. Golf and sports field construction preferred
  • Diploma or certification in Turfgrass Management, Landscape Construction, Civil Construction, Horticulture, or related field (preferred).
  • Proven experience of successfully managing multiple crews or projects simultaneously.

Skills & Competencies

  • Strong leadership, organizational, and communication skills.
  • Ability to read and interpret landscape and construction drawings.
  • Working knowledge of sports field and golf course management along with turf protocols.
  • Proficient with basic construction tools, equipment, and materials.
  • Sound understanding of grading, drainage, hardscape installation, and plant identification.
  • Basic computer or mobile app proficiency for time tracking and reporting.

Licenses & Certifications

  • Valid Ontario G driver’s license (AR or AZ an asset).
  • Current First Aid/CPR and WHMIS certifications preferred

The incumbent will be required to provide a clean criminal background check at the offer stage.

Working Conditions

  • Outdoor work in varying weather conditions.
  • Physically demanding environment with lifting, bending, and operation of tools and machinery.
  • Occasional overtime and weekend work during peak season.
